RESUMEN

Background: The triple burden of COVID-19, tuberculosis and human immunodeficiency virus is one of the major global health challenges of the 21 st century. In high burden HIV/TB countries, the spread of COVID-19 among people living with HIV is a well-founded concern. A thorough understanding of HIV/TB and COVID-19 pandemics is important as the three diseases interact. This may clarify HIV/TB/COVID-19 as a newly related field and play an important role in the present and future management of the co-infections. However, several gaps are remaining in the knowledge of the burden of COVID-19 on patients with TB and HIV, the diagnosis, and management of these patients. Objectives The study was conducted to review different studies on SARS-CoV, MERS-CoV or COVID-19 associated with HIV/TB co-infection or only TB and to understand the interactions between HIV, TB and COVID-19 and its implications on the burden of the COVID-19 among HIV/TB co-infected or TB patients, screening algorithm and clinical management. Methods We conducted electronic search of potential eligible studies published in English in the Cochrane Controlled Register of Trials, PubMed, Medrxiv, Google scholar and Clinical Trials Registry databases. We included case studies, case series and observational studies published between January, 2002 and March, 2020 in which SARS-CoV, MERS-CoV and COVID-19 co-infected to HIV/TB or TB were managed in adult patients. We screened titles, abstracts and full articles for eligibility. As we anticipated heterogeneity in the literature, results were reported narratively. Main results After removing 69 duplicates, 24 out of 246 articles were assessed for eligibility, of which 9 studies were included for qualitative analysis. Among them, we included two case reports, four case series, one case-control and two retrospective observational studies. The studies have shown that TB may occur during or after SARS-CoV. In terms of severity, the proportion of severe/critical SARS, MERS and COVID cases with TB co-infection was higher than in patients with mild/moderate stages (P= 0.0008). Conclusion SARS/MERS-CoV/COVID-19 associated to HIV/TB or TB subjects had a higher risk of developing severe/critical than mild/moderate SARS/MERS-CoV/COVID-19. Diagnostic algorithms and clinical management were suggested for efficiently improving COVID-19/HIV/TB co-infections outcomes.

RESUMEN

In Kenya, millions of children have limited access to nurturing care. With the COVID-19 pandemic, it is anticipated that vulnerable children will bear the biggest brunt of the direct and indirect impacts of the pandemic. This review aimed to deepen understanding of the effects of COVID-19 on nurturing care from conception to four years of age, a period where the care of children is often delivered through caregivers or other informal platforms. The review has drawn upon the empirical evidence from previous pandemics and epidemics, and anecdotal and emerging evidence from the ongoing COVID-19 crisis. Multifactorial impacts fall into five key domains: direct health; health and nutrition systems, economic, social and child protection, and child development and early learning. The review proposes program and policy strategies to guide the re-orientation of nurturing care, prevent the detrimental effects associated with deteriorating nurturing care environments, and support the optimal development of the youngest and most vulnerable children. These include the provision of cash transfers and essential supplies for vulnerable households, and strengthening of community-based platforms for nurturing care. Further research on COVID-19 and the ability of children’s ecology to provide nurturing care is needed, as is further testing of new ideas.
